十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
1、举个例子,比如如下是HTML的结构:这里推荐使用jQuery库,比较方便。以下是代码:大致思路就是:先利用name属性值获取checkbox对象,然后循环判断checked属性。
成都创新互联公司主要从事成都网站制作、成都做网站、网页设计、企业做网站、公司建网站等业务。立足成都服务嘉黎,10余年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:18980820575
2、取得jQuery 对象中元素的个数,可以用两种方法:var valueDate = $(.datePicker).size();这个是jQuery提供的方法(method),因需要用括号进行调用。
3、方法:获取多选下拉框对象数组→循环判断option选项的selected属性(true为选中,false为未选中)→使用value属性取出选中项的值。
4、(table :checkbox):查找table元素下面,所有的多选框。
5、可以考虑用length属性, jquery代码: $(“#ulname li”).length。ul 是 Unordered List(无序列表)的缩写。与之相对的有有序列表标签,列表里的项目用标签记述,所有主流浏览器都支持 标签。
6、具有高效灵活的css选择器,并且可对CSS选择器进行扩展;拥有便捷的插件扩展机制和丰富的插件。jQuery兼容各种主流浏览器,如IE 0+、FF 5+、Safari 0+、Opera 0+等。
由前端控制。每次用户点击后,计数并将数值存储到cookie或者localStorage,每次点击时,先行判断是否达到上限。优势在于相对快速实现,弊端在于懂开发的人手动清理cookie和本地存储的数值。由前后端协同控制。
你可以在你自己的网站上加一个跟踪代码,再做些设置,就可以监测到这些链接的点击数。
) 方法返回元素的顺序是它们在文档中的顺序。
== $(#b1)[0]){ alert(你点了按钮一!);}else if(e.target == $(#b2)[0]){ alert(你点了按钮二!);} });可以试试我这个,因为jQuery选择器的原因,所以一定要指定父级,否则会执行多次。
解决的方法:用jQuery的方式 jQuery专门为此功能提供了一个函数one。这样写就能让click这个事件只执行一次。
jquery如何判断checkbox是否被选中,很简单的,一句代码:(input[type=checkbox]).is(:checked)这是一个判断条件,如果选中,系统会返回true,未选中当然是false了 然后根据自己的需要,做对应的需求。
如果没被选中,打印出的是undefined。
这里是jq来实现全选,所以引入jQuery,并且给按钮绑定一个jQuery类型的点击事件即可。然后通过prop来设置input的属性即可设置全选了,prop是jq自带的一个方法。
is(:checked)是一个非常好用的jQuery方法,可以很快地判断多选对象是不是被选中了。
思路:jquery 获取select多选下拉框所有选项的值,可以通过选取多选的数组进行循环判断即可。
).length; 在你选择单选按钮之前就运行了(按顺序由上向下运行),当然是0了。
//首先,你的想法和思路是对的,但你忽略了一个问题,jquery的选择器中表达式是操作dom的,//用变量连接表达式,看似没毛病,但实际在jquery中的实现是不能正常执行的。